For the first time since back in December of 2024, Pleasant Valley was forced to settle for a draw on Wednesday. Neither they nor the Chico Panthers could gain the upper hand so the two teams had to settle for a 0-0 draw. There's a chance things could've gone differently had the Vikings not been charged with a red card from Ryder Puritz.
Pleasant Valley's draw gives them a new season record of 6-1-4. Meanwhile, Chico's record is now 5-4-2.
The future could be bright for both Pleasant Valley and Chico: their next opponents haven't had the best luck recently. Pleasant Valley will try to hand Foothill their fourth-straight loss when the two meet at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. Meanwhile, Chico will look to extend Enterprise's four-game losing streak when the meet at 7:00 p.m. on Friday.
